AUGUSTA - State Rep. Sue Austin compiled a perfect voting record during the 2007 legislative session. The Republican lawmaker from Gray was present for all 199 recorded votes cast in the House of Representatives during the First Regular Session of the 123rd Legislature. Sue has maintained this perfect voting record for the duration of her service over the past five years. "The people of my district are present through me," said Rep. Austin, a third-term lawmaker. "If I am not present, they are not represented on the issues through my vote, plain and simple." After being sworn into office in December, legislators spent almost six months in Augusta before wrapping up their work in June. The legislature held 62 session days in which lawmakers considered 1930 pieces of legislation, of which more than 500 where signed into law. Rep. Austin serves on the Legislature's Business Research and Economic Development Committee and Ethics Committee.
